Technical Analysis

From a technical perspective, GURE is currently trading near the midpoint of its recent near-term trading range, with an identified immediate support level at $5.14 and immediate resistance level at $5.68. The stock’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the neutral range, neither approaching overbought nor oversold territory, which suggests there is no extreme bullish or bearish momentum priced into the stock at current levels. Short-term moving averages are hovering close to GURE’s $5.41 current price, indicating a lack of a strong established near-term trend, while longer-term moving averages reflect a mild sideways trading pattern over the past several weeks. The recent 1.64% pullback has brought the stock slightly closer to its identified support level, with no obvious technical signals of an imminent breakout in either direction as of current trading sessions. Market participants often monitor the $5.14 support level for signs of sustained buying interest, while the $5.68 resistance level is watched for signs of selling pressure that could prevent upward movement. Outlook

Looking ahead, there are two key scenarios market participants are monitoring for GURE in the upcoming weeks. If the stock is able to trade above the $5.68 resistance level on above-average volume, that could potentially signal a shift to a more bullish near-term trend, with the stock possibly moving into a higher trading range. Conversely, a break below the $5.14 support level on elevated trading volume may indicate rising bearish sentiment, potentially leading to further testing of lower historical price levels. As there are no company-specific catalysts expected in the immediate term, GURE’s performance will likely be heavily tied to broader sector trends: rising industrial commodity prices could act as a tailwind for the stock, while weaker-than-expected manufacturing data may act as a headwind. Analysts estimate that GURE will likely remain in its current trading range in the near term unless there is a significant shift in broader market sentiment or an unexpected material announcement from the company.
